Zune should be based upon an industry standard

in both hardware and software connectivity. The ipod has the industry catering to them with connections, software controllability etc. MS needs to get together with Sony, Creative, Iriver and other players and say we are going to get together and uphold a standard for both connectivity (cars stereos, tv's, portable speakers to allow superior sound over the usual stereo connection) and software. If MS can do this then it will allow for people to have more options to purchase outside of apple. Lets face it the ipod is not the best sounding device. If MS can do this with creative, sony and samsung, they could swing apple into joining this standard that would allow people more choices. If MS comes out with raw power and just Zune itself, they will struggle more. You have to get a standard established. This way when I go to purchase a new mp3 car stereo or TV I can have good connectors for a variety of portable players...you guys should know this already. Thanks.
